I am trying to sync 260 GBytes, about 450k files altogether, from a macOS system to Linux. Both are running Syncthing 1.28.1.
While underway it can transfer at about 50 Mbps, but the transfer has repeatedly stalled and sat there transferring no data for several hours. On the originating Mac if I pause the destination Linux machine and then Resume it, the transfer will start making progress again and transfer a few more gigabytes before stalling.
